If you haven't seen national player of the year Sierra Romero then you should tune in if for nothing else.

Sierra is a bulldog.  5'4" power hitter to all fields.   Her .469 batting average is tied for ninth in the country and ranks first in the Big Ten. She also leads the conference in RBI (74), runs (76) and walks (51).
